6+ Best Top Grade Ammo Books for Collectors

A guide to premium ammunition can take various forms, from a detailed printed volume to a comprehensive online resource. Such a resource might include detailed specifications of various cartridges, including bullet weight, powder load, and casing material. It could also feature performance data like muzzle velocity, ballistic coefficient, and effective range. Example content might cover comparisons of different brands or types of ammunition for specific purposes, such as hunting, target shooting, or self-defense.

Access to reliable and detailed information on high-quality ammunition is crucial for informed decision-making. Selecting the right ammunition improves accuracy, enhances firearm performance, and increases safety. Historically, knowledge of ammunition was often passed down through experienced shooters and hunters or found in specialized publications. Modern resources offer greater accessibility and more detailed data, enabling users to optimize their ammunition choices for various firearms and applications. This careful selection process can also contribute to the preservation of firearms by minimizing wear and tear caused by incompatible or low-quality ammunition.

7+ Free Book Report Templates (7th Grade)

A structured framework designed for students in seventh grade to summarize and analyze literary works typically includes sections for bibliographic information, plot summaries, character analyses, thematic explorations, and personal reflections. An example might involve designated spaces for recording the title, author, genre, setting, main characters, rising action, climax, falling action, resolution, and a concluding paragraph summarizing the student’s overall impression of the book.

Providing such frameworks offers several advantages. These pre-designed formats guide students through the critical thinking process required for literary analysis, helping them organize their thoughts and express their understanding effectively. They can also foster consistent evaluation across a class, enabling educators to assess comprehension and analytical skills more readily. Historically, standardized approaches to literary analysis have evolved to equip students with essential skills applicable beyond the classroom, including concise communication, critical thinking, and persuasive argumentation.

8+ Free Printable Teacher Grade Books (PDF)

A physical or digital record-keeping system designed for educators allows for the organized tracking of student assessment results. Common features include space for student names, assignment details, scores, and often calculations for overall grades. A tangible version might be a bound book with pre-printed columns and rows, while digital options range from spreadsheets to dedicated software applications. The printable format offers flexibility, allowing educators to customize and adapt the record-keeping system to specific classroom needs.

Organized record-keeping is essential for effective teaching and learning. Such systems provide a clear overview of individual student progress and overall class performance. This data informs instructional adjustments, identifies areas requiring additional support, and facilitates communication with students, parents, and administrators. Historically, educators relied on handwritten ledgers. The evolution to printable and digital formats streamlined the process, increased efficiency, and provided more robust analytical capabilities.
